Q: Is 46,500,254 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 46,500,254 is a composite number.

Why is 46,500,254 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 46,500,254 can be evenly divided by 1 2 2,903 5,806 8,009 16,018 23,250,127 and 46,500,254, with no remainder.

Since 46,500,254 cannot be divided by just 1 and 46,500,254, it is a composite number.
